Analysis of Stage Fright
It was the perfect night,
The stage was set,
Everything was going right.
But in a moment of hesitation,
You broke out with stage fright,
What was I to do with you?
So I acted very nonchalant,
And told you that it was cool.
Mean while, deep down inside,
Something told me I was a fool,
Where did it all go so wrong?
Was it in the very first act?
Or maybe the opening song,
With all that in mind,
I took a load off my shoulders,
A little me time to unwind.
Unsure of what really happened,
What would I eventually find?
I will play this part till the end,
Hoping that maybe the next time,
You can get it right, my friend.
